Output 3cab8edf25f30664db08a86f2ee6052a2ea46613e248c06a54588e232b2ae7d7:19

value
13114414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f42d454c55011b3e24ee5bab5e4e3d7d9bfce817 OP_EQUAL
address
MWAFLhYki7uYojEcZ3t5rzG4judgWEZCFa
transaction
3cab8edf25f30664db08a86f2ee6052a2ea46613e248c06a54588e232b2ae7d7
spent
true